Course Description

Overview

Learn how to develop your personal credibility as a speaker—and quickly establish that you're a person who's worth listening to.

Syllabus

Introduction
  • Developing your personal credibility
1. The Nonverbals
  • Use your eyes
  • Look the part
  • Consider your voice
2. The Emotions
  • Read the room
  • Use your body language and tone of voice
  • Deal with difficult audience emotions
3. The Facts
  • Research your audience
  • State your credentials
  • Prepare for surprises
4. Put It All Together
  • Small room credibility: Case study
  • Large room credibility: Case study
Conclusion
  • Next steps
